RELATING TO LOAN REPAYMENT FOR HEALTHCARE PROFESSIONALS.
SB 1626 appropriates state funds to expand the Healthcare Education Loan Repayment Program. It directly helps licensed healthcare professionals (like doctors, nurses, and therapists) working in underserved areas by repaying their student loans. The key provision is allocating new state budget money to cover repayment costs, reducing financial burdens for providers in high-need communities. This is a funding bill, not a new law creating requirements.
